Ho-Oh's Debut in Pokemon Unite

Pokemon Unite has revealed the move set for the Fire/Flying-type Legendary Pokemon Ho-Oh, who's arriving with the game's third anniversary update on July 19. In Pokemon Unite, Ho-Oh will have powerful fire-based abilities that will employ various debuffing effects on enemy Pokemon.

TiMi Studio Group and The Pokemon Company's Pokemon Unite is a competitive MOBA game for Nintendo Switch, iOS, and Android platforms. Teams of five players compete to score points, which can be earned by depositing energy into the enemy's goal zones. This energy is gained by defeating wild Pokemon and opposing team members during the match. Players may earn XP, unlock new abilities, and strengthen their Pokemon, with new playable Pokemon being regularly added to the game.

The Pokemon Company released a new Pokemon Unite trailer that reveals the full move set for Legendary Pokemon Ho-Oh from the Johto region. Firstly, Ho-Oh is a ranged defender with a difficulty level of novice, so new Pokemon Unite players shouldn't have much trouble getting used to the Pokemon's move set. Ho-Oh has a special healing ability called Regenerator, which gradually recovers HP if the Pokemon doesn't receive damage for a set amount of time. Ho-Oh's Fly ability allows the Pokemon to move freely over walls while increasing their movement speed and attack, granting three boosted attacks, and dealing damage to nearby opposing Pokemon after touching down. Further, the Fire Spin ability generates a flaming vortex around Ho-Oh, dealing damage and applying a slowing effect to nearby opponents. Fire Spin also grants a temporary shield that emits a heat wave around Ho-Oh that deals additional damage inside the vortex.

Taking cues from Ho-Oh's Incinerate ability in Pokemon GO, the Pokemon's Flamethrower ability lets the user spread flames toward opposing Pokemon, lowering the damage values of their attacks and special attacks. The cooldown duration will be increased if the user prolongs the use of Ho-Oh's Flamethrower, and Pokemon that are burned by the ability will receive a debuff to their movement speed. Burned Pokemon will also leave a scorching trail that damages other opposing Pokemon and lowers their movement speed as well.

Similarly to Fly, the Sky Attack ability sends Ho-Oh soaring through the air. Sky Attack leaves a scorching trail just like the Flamethrower ability, damaging enemies and applying a slowing effect to them. Moreover, Ho-Oh features a useful Unite Attack called Rekindling Flame, which revives nearby fallen Pokemon by spreading feathers and consuming Aeos energy. With Ho-Oh joining the fray, Pokemon Unite's third anniversary update will surely shake up the in-game meta.
